Zanzibar

Just off the coast of Tanzania lies an entrancing archipelago known as Zanzibar. This gorgeous string of islands is the land of sultans, palaces beaches and spice-filled markets. Once an important trading center, many restorations have been done in recent years to restore Zanzibar to its ancient grandeur - earning its capital city UNESCO World Heritage status in 2000.

Asuncion

Asuncion is a vastly underrated city. It is the capital but also the administrative economic and cultural center of Paraguay. It is located in the south central part of the country, near the border with Argentina and it is one of the oldest cities in South America, with people living here since almost 500 years. The city has a beautiful and simple center, with a few unique colonial and beaux arts buildings, international cuisine, shady plazas and friendly people. Its handful of historic buildings around the Plaza de los Heroes, Plaza Uruguaya and Manzana de la Ribera, two or three small museums, old bars and cafes, but also smart suburbs, ritzy shopping malls and fashionable nightclubs will keep you entertained for a day or two. It is a very charming city for travellers and apart from the sights, the city boasts a good tourist infrastructure with hotels and restaurants.

Which place is cheaper, Asuncion or Zanzibar?

These are the overall average travel costs for the two destinations.

The average daily cost (per person) in Zanzibar is $51, while the average daily cost in Asuncion is $67.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. While every person is different, these costs are an average of past travelers in each destination. What follows is a categorical breakdown of travel costs for Zanzibar and Asuncion in more detail.

Typical Weather for Asuncion and Zanzibar

Zanzibar Asuncion
Temp (°C) Rain (mm) Temp (°C) Rain (mm)
Jan 28°C (82°F) 78 mm (3.1 in) 29°C (84°F) 150 mm (5.9 in)
Feb 28°C (82°F) 52 mm (2 in) 27°C (81°F) 140 mm (5.5 in)
Mar 28°C (83°F) 131 mm (5.2 in) 26°C (79°F) 140 mm (5.5 in)
Apr 27°C (81°F) 269 mm (10.6 in) 24°C (75°F) 150 mm (5.9 in)
May 26°C (78°F) 176 mm (6.9 in) 21°C (70°F) 110 mm (4.3 in)
Jun 24°C (76°F) 42 mm (1.7 in) 19°C (66°F) 50 mm (2 in)
Jul 25°C (77°F) 31 mm (1.2 in) 19°C (66°F) 30 mm (1.2 in)
Aug 24°C (75°F) 27 mm (1.1 in) 21°C (70°F) 50 mm (2 in)
Sep 25°C (76°F) 28 mm (1.1 in) 22°C (72°F) 70 mm (2.8 in)
Oct 25°C (78°F) 66 mm (2.6 in) 25°C (77°F) 130 mm (5.1 in)
Nov 27°C (80°F) 132 mm (5.2 in) 26°C (79°F) 150 mm (5.9 in)
Dec 27°C (81°F) 116 mm (4.6 in) 28°C (82°F) 150 mm (5.9 in)
